Subject: Handover — Stormline Alert Fan-out

Hi Verena,

Before I rotate off-call, here's the state of the weather-alert fan-out for the Stormline service. The dispatcher polls the alerts table every 20 seconds and fans out to regional queues; dedupe is keyed on alert hash plus county code. I bumped the worker pool to 12 after the Gale Harbor backlog last week. Replication lag alerts are still tuned conservatively. For review, the fan-out workers read from the replica using the connection string below.

replica DSN, kajep-yahag: mssql://praok_svc:iF@db-8d68.plorvaio.local:5432/eliion

**Alert: Offline sync backlog — Trailnote field-survey app**

Heads up: this fires when queued offline survey entries on Trailnote devices exceed the sync threshold for over an hour. Usually it's a conflict-resolution bug or a schema mismatch after a release. Check the latest merge to the sync module before digging deeper. Questions or false-positive reports go to the address below.

escalation mailbox, bafog-fafog: ulador@paliqlabs.internal

Subject: Cut-over summary — Quillbend template engine

Hi Soren,

The cut-over to the precompiled Quillbend renderer completed last night without rollback. Median render time dropped from roughly 140ms to 22ms, and the cache hit rate has held steady since the warm-up finished. Two tenants needed manual cache invalidation; both confirmed fixed this morning. No open incidents remain. For your records and the release notes, the production settings we went live with are listed below.

deployment values, yadup-kadug:
[sorys]
port = 5672
team = noveth
host = sorys.orvexcorp.example
region = south-4
access_code = ac_deddc1
timeout_ms = 1500

Handover — Evac-Chair Store

Reception, quick note before I'm off. The evacuation-chair store behind Stairwell C at Fenwright Tower was restocked Tuesday; two chairs, both serviced. Keep the cupboard clear — no umbrellas, no lost property. Log any opening in the red binder. Maintenance from Oakhall comes monthly; expect them Thursday. The cupboard keypad was reset this week, so use the new code below.

staff pass of kawip-hawef = bdg-QLP-2